Femoral component

Asymmetric

  •  The implant maintains a 10° A/P angle to approximate the anatomical form of the distal condyle.

 

Anatomical

  • The implant is available in seven sizes to allow for patient-specific fitting.

Three planar resections and two peg holes create a consistent, congruent cement interface.

Versatility Sizes 1, 2, and 3 are interchangeable, with slightly different cuts and peg placements than sizes 3–7. Sizes 3, 4, 5, 6, and 7 all have the exact same planar resections and peg hole locations.

 

Asymmetric

  • The right medial component can be utilized on the left lateral tibia, while the left medial component can be used on the right lateral tibia.

 

Flexibility

  • The all-poly version and the metal-backed version have the same instrumentation, providing for easy intraoperative choice.

 

Unconstrained kinematics

  • Unconstrained kinematics can be achieved by connecting a curved femoral component on a flat articular surface.
